Strong's Concordance H6723

Original Word: צִיָּה
Transliteration: tsîyâh
Phonetic Spelling: tsee-yaw'
from an unused root meaning to parch; aridity; concretely, a desert; barren, drought, dry (land, place), solitary place, wilderness.
